MUSKOGEE COUNTY, Okla. — Around 32,000 marijuana plants, 5,000 pounds of untraceable processed pot, and six firearms were seized from several growing operations and dispensaries in Muskogee County last week, according to Attorney General Gentner Drummond. 

The inspections were carried out by the Organized Crime Task Force, the Oklahoma Medical Marijuana Authority, the Muskogee Police Department, and the Muscogee Creek Nation Lighthorse Police Department.

As a result, 47-year-old Jinhe Chen was arrested for aggravated manufacturing and trafficking. 

"These actions are the latest example of my efforts to dismantle illegal drug trafficking operations that endanger our communities," Drummond said. "I will continue to target and prosecute anyone associated with these dangerous criminal enterprises."
